Overview

Strider Technologies is a strategic intelligence company founded in 2019 by twin brothers Greg Levesque and Eric Levesque. Based in Utah, Strider specializes in leveraging open-source data combined with artificial intelligence to provide crucial insights into state-sponsored risk and supply chain vulnerabilities. As a fast-growing company in the cybersecurity and intelligence sector, Strider has raised significant capital, including a $55 million Series C funding in 2024, led by Pelion Venture Partners.

Recent Developments

  • September 2024: Strider Technologies announced the opening of a Tokyo office, responding to increased demand for its services in Japan, its fastest-growing international market. This expansion is part of its strategy to support economic security solutions across Asia Pacific.
  • August 2024: David Vigneault, the former head of Canadian intelligence, joined Strider as Managing Director. Additionally, the company launched "Strider Impact," an initiative aimed at empowering academic research on national security.
  • May 2024: Strider updated its flagship Risk Intelligence Solution. Promotions included Yvonne Bigbee as Chief Technology Officer and Mike Brown as Chief Data Officer.
  • November 2023: Enhanced services were rolled out aimed at supporting economic security teams to mitigate state-sponsored risks, focusing on training, strategy development, and organizational education.
  • October 2023: The company launched a new Data Catalog targeted at aiding government agencies in identifying state-sponsored risks.

Early History

Strider Technologies was founded in 2019 by Greg and Eric Levesque, driven by their backgrounds and language skills in strategic intelligence. The company was initially headquartered in Washington D.C., before moving to Utah in 2021. Early on, Strider raised $2 million in seed funding, which was used to develop their proprietary technologies aimed at countering intellectual property theft from state-sponsored actors.

Company Profile and Achievements

Strider Technologies provides strategic intelligence solutions using a combination of open-source intelligence and AI, designed to safeguard intellectual property and secure supply chains against state-sponsored threats. Its flagship products include:

  • Spark AI: A generative AI-powered tool that provides answers to critical supply chain queries.
  • Ranger and Shield: Risk intelligence and email security solutions that assist organizations in managing threats linked to state actors.
  • Supply Chain Intelligence: This helps in screening supply chains for security, reputational, and compliance risks. Over the years, Strider has partnered with Fortune 100 companies and has secured strategic agreements, significantly enhancing its market reach.

Current Operations and Market Position

Strider Technologies continues to expand its global footprint, with offices operational in Salt Lake City, Washington D.C., London, and Tokyo. The company works extensively with government agencies, universities, and private sector clients to mitigate risks associated with intellectual property theft and geopolitical threats. Recent funding has been used to further develop its AI-driven platform and expand operations in Europe and Asia.
